About this item
- The Little Stopper is a long exposure filter that reduces the amount of light entering your lens by six stops
- It is ideal for those low-light conditions at the beginning and end of the day (when a darker filter may prove too much), allowing you to enjoy increased flexibility with exposure times
- By greatly extending exposure times, the Little Stopper has the effect of allowing anything that is moving in your image to become blurred or ghost like, for example clouds, waterfalls, rivers, and the sea. The filter can also be used on cityscapes to blur people or on roads and motorways to blur traffic
- Used creatively the Little Stopper can change the way we look at moving objects and capture a real sense of time passing in your images

I have about 10 complete Lee Foundation systems and almost everything Lee makes with the exception of the Little Stopper so this was a must try.
The 1.8 stop filter is (as with everything Lee makes) made extremely well. hHaving the 1.8 comes in a LOT handier in more instances then using the Lee 10 stop Big Stopper and therefore I think you;ll find yourself using it more often.
I did do several tests stacking the Lee Big & Little Stoppers (a total of 16 stops) and the results were excellent.

Stacking stoppers is always going to be problematic. Used singularly they should always be used in the slot closest to the lens with the foam gasket facing the lens. The gasket seals the filter against the filter holder to prevent light leakage. If you add a second stopper in the next slot there are two open sides that will allow light to leak in and hence overexpose and flare. You would need to seal these gaps somehow (black tape or otherwise) to use two together.
